Step into the world of weddings with The Aisle, a brutally honest and informative bridal podcast that leaves no topic unexplored. Join your host, Trista Croce, the founder and CEO of BTS Event Management, a renowned luxury wedding and events company. Frequently Asked Questions About The Aisle

What is The Aisle about and what kind of topics does it cover?

Focused on the world of weddings, this podcast provides a mix of informative discussions and personal insights related to wedding planning, trends, and experiences shared by industry experts. The episodes explore a wide range of topics, including engagement planning, the role of wedding planners, budget management, and the emotional aspects of wedding preparations. Additionally, special guests from the bridal industry share unique perspectives that enhance the narrative around modern wedding experiences. The dynamic and casual tone invites listeners to engage with the often complex and emotional journey of wedding planning.
